Team News: Leighton Baines back for Everton against Newcastle United

Leighton Baines makes his first appearance for Everton this month against Newcastle United after recovering from a thigh strain.

England left-back Leighton Baines has recovered from a thigh strain to start for Everton in this afternoon's Premier League match against Newcastle United.

Baines's inclusion is one of five changes made by Roberto Martinez to the side that beat Dynamo Kiev 2-1 in Thursday night's Europa League tie.

Luke Garbutt drops to the bench for Baines, while the other changes see Darron Gibson, Aaron Lennon, Leon Osman and Arouna Kone return.

Newcastle, meanwhile, play their first match in 11 days and John Carver makes two changes to the side that fell to Manchester United last time out.

Jack Colback returns from suspension in place of Mehdi Abeid, while Yoan Gouffran replaces banned striker Papiss Cisse, who serves the first of his seven-game suspension for spitting at United defender Jonny Evans.

Everton: Howard; Coleman, Jagielka, Alcaraz, Baines; McCarthy, Gibson; Lennon, Osman, Kone; Lukaku
Subs: Robles, Naismith, Besic, Atsu, Barkley, Stones, Garbutt

Newcastle: Krul; Janmaat, Coloccini, Williamson, R.Taylor; Colback, Sissoko; Obertan, Gouffran, Ameobi; Riviere
Subs: Elliot, Satka, Anita, Gutierrez, Cabella, Armstrong, Perez
